Your Treatment Journey
Consultation and Preparation: We clean the treatment area and may use a topical anaesthetic to manage comfort during the procedure.
Clinical Application: Using specific clinical instruments, volume-restoring product is placed at the jaw's angle and chin junction to address symmetry and support.
Refinement: A gentle massage may be performed to ensure the product is well-integrated for a smooth appearance.
Most sessions are performed in-clinic, allowing patients to return to their daily activities following their appointment.

FAQs
How long do the effects of jawline treatments last?
Outcomes typically persist for 9 to 12 months, though this varies between individuals. Factors such as metabolism and lifestyle can influence longevity.
Is the procedure uncomfortable?
Discomfort varies between individuals. We use numbing cream and gentle techniques to manage the experience. Most patients report a minor sensation during the process.
Can treatment address asymmetry?
Yes. By strategically placing product based on individual anatomy, we can address uneven contours to support a more balanced profile.
